The Nissan NV100 Clipper Rio Kei Car Turbo is a compact and efficient vehicle designed to meet the unique demands of urban driving, making it an excellent choice for New Zealand’s city environments and narrow rural roads. Originating from Japan's Kei car segment, this model benefits from a lightweight chassis combined with a turbocharged engine that balances performance and fuel economy.
Under the hood, the NV100 Clipper Rio features a small displacement turbocharged engine typically around 660cc, delivering sufficient power for both city commuting and short highway trips. Its compact size and tight turning radius are ideal for navigating Auckland's busy streets or the tight parking spaces found in Wellington’s downtown areas. The kei car classification also means the vehicle is inherently designed for ease of use, low emissions, and affordability in maintenance.
The interior offers surprising practicality given its modest exterior dimensions. It provides enough space to comfortably accommodate four adults, with smartly arranged controls focused on functionality. The minimalist dashboard includes user-friendly technology tailored for convenience rather than luxury. Additionally, this Nissan model often comes with safety features like ABS brakes and airbags that cater well to New Zealand’s stringent safety standards.
When it comes to New Zealand's varied weather conditions—ranging from wet winters to hot summers—the NV100 Clipper Rio performs reliably thanks to its sturdy build and dependable engineering. However, as a front-wheel-drive vehicle with modest ground clearance, it's best suited for paved roads rather than rugged off-road terrains commonly found in remote regions of New Zealand.
